72484c2c83
git-svn-id: svn://svn.code.sf.net/p/rdesktop/code/trunk/rdesktop@850 423420c4-83ab-492f-b58f-81f9feb106b5
25 lines
671 B
Plaintext
25 lines
671 B
Plaintext
#
|
|
# qtrdesktop makefile
|
|
# qt should be installed in /usr/local/qt
|
|
#
|
|
CC = g++
|
|
CPPFLAGS = -O2 -Wall -I/usr/local/qt/include
|
|
RESTOBJ = ../tcp.o ../iso.o ../mcs.o ../secure.o ../rdp.o ../rdp5.o ../orders.o ../cache.o ../mppc.o ../licence.o ../bitmap.o ../channels.o ../pstcache.o
|
|
LD2FLAGS = -L/usr/local/qt/lib -L/usr/X11R6/lib
|
|
LDFLAGS = -lcrypto -lqt -lXext -lX11 -lm
|
|
MOCFILE = /usr/local/qt/bin/moc
|
|
|
|
all: qtrd
|
|
|
|
qtrd: $(RESTOBJ) qtwin.o
|
|
$(MOCFILE) qtwin.h > moc_qtwin.cpp
|
|
$(CC) $(CPPFLAGS) -c moc_qtwin.cpp
|
|
$(CC) -o qtrdesktop $(LD2FLAGS) qtwin.o moc_qtwin.o $(RESTOBJ) $(LDFLAGS)
|
|
strip qtrdesktop
|
|
|
|
clean:
|
|
rm -f qtrdesktop
|
|
rm -f *.o
|
|
rm -f ../*.o
|
|
rm -f moc_qtwin.cpp
|